Factors to Consider When Choosing End Mill Holders

At the time of choosing end mill holders, you need to focus on the material quality and guarantee the shank taper matches your machine. Pay close attention to the tool holding mechanism and the range of sizes available for your specific needs. Precision and tolerance also play a vital role in maintaining accuracy during machining.

Shank Taper Compatibility

Because your end mill holder’s shank taper must match your machine spindle type-such as R8 or Morse Taper (MT)-you’ll guarantee a secure fit and reliable tool holding. The taper size directly affects stability and concentricity, which in turn influence machining accuracy and surface finish quality. You also need to verify compatibility between the holder’s taper and the drawbar thread type and size to prevent tool slippage during operation. Precision in taper angle and dimensions is vital for a tight fit, minimizing runout, especially in high-speed or heavy-duty milling. Different taper systems, like R8 or MT2, offer varied rigidity and ease of tool changes, so choose one that aligns with your specific machining demands for peak performance.

Tool Holding Mechanism

Matching your end mill holder’s shank taper to your machine spindle sets the stage for secure tool holding, but the mechanism that grips the cutting tool itself plays an equally vital role. You’ll want a holding system-often set screws or drawbar threads-that firmly fastens the end mill’s shank to prevent slippage during heavy milling. High rigidity and stability matter most to minimize vibration and guarantee consistent cuts. Precision tolerance in the gripping area is imperative, too, to maintain concentricity and reduce runout for accurate machining. Additionally, consider whether your holder accommodates single-ended or double-ended end mills, as this affects versatility and tool choice. Prioritize a mechanism designed for both compatibility and durability to enhance your machining precision and performance.

Size Range Availability

When selecting end mill holders, you need to take into account the size range carefully to guarantee a perfect fit for your tool shank. End mill holders come in various sizes, typically from 3/16″ up to 3/4″ or larger, accommodating different shank diameters. Choosing the exact size minimizes tool slippage and guarantees secure holding during machining. Many sets include multiple sizes, giving you versatility to work with both single-ended and double-ended end mills. Keep in mind that size availability often ties to specific taper types like R8 or Morse taper, so you’ll want to verify compatibility with your machine’s spindle. Matching the holder size to your tool shank precisely is essential for effective performance and reliable milling results.

What Maintenance Is Required for End Mill Holders?

You should regularly clean your end mill holders to remove debris, inspect for wear or damage, lubricate moving parts when needed, and guarantee proper tightening. This keeps your tools precise and prolongs their lifespan.

How to Measure the Correct Size for an End Mill Holder?

You measure the correct end mill holder size through checking your end mill’s shank diameter and length. Use calipers for precise measurement, then match those dimensions with the holder’s specifications to guarantee a secure fit.
